### Step 6 — Push the counter build

After verifying the Gatewise turnstile counter passes the dry-run at Harrow Dome's north concourse, package the build with the contractor toolchain and tag it with today's date. Do not reuse tags from prior deployments, as the ingest service rejects duplicates. Authenticate the push to the stadium fleet with the deploy key that follows.

rollout seal: bky4_x7Gc

Three environments exist: dev (mail trapped locally), staging (delivers to an internal inbox only), and production. Future maintainers should note that staging shares the template bundle with production but uses a separate sending domain, so rendering differences usually indicate a template-cache issue rather than drift. Always promote template changes through staging first and verify a sample receipt end to end. The production environment currently runs with the configuration values below.

deployment values, taweg-bajop:
[fenvan]
port = 5672
team = holmir
host = fenvan.orvexio.example
region = lower-1
access_code = ac_b98bc6
timeout_ms = 1500

# Service Accounts — Ploughwire Gateway

The Ploughwire telemetry gateway uses one service account per region. Accounts are read-write on the ingest topic only. Rotation is quarterly, automated via the Hayrick job. Never reuse a regional account for staging.

For local testing against the staging gateway, authenticate with the key below.

API key for fadug-fafof: kto7_7rjklQM

Heads up: the audit-log viewer in Pexley filters by actor and action type, but the date picker defaults to UTC, which trips people up constantly. When reviewing changes here, double-check that any new filter params are reflected in the export CSV too — they diverged once before and support tickets piled up. The full filter-param mapping lives on the internal wiki page here.

operations page: https://jira.qorvelsys.internal/browse/pages/browse/pages

Subject: Partner SFTP drop — new owner

Hi,

As you review the pending changes to the Harborline ingest scripts, note that ownership of the partner SFTP drop is changing at the end of the month. This includes key rotation, the nightly pull job, and the quarantine folder for malformed files. Review comments on the retry logic should still go through the normal PR flow, but questions about drop-folder conventions or partner onboarding now go to the new owner. The incoming owner is listed below.

signatory, tagaf-bahaf: Praael Fenmir Rusok